#NextGenATP Italian Zeppieri Seals Roland Garros Qualification

#NextGenATP Italian Giulio Zeppieri will make his main-draw debut at Roland Garros after overcoming Frenchman Sean Cuenin 6-3, 6-4 in the third qualifying round on Thursday.

The 20-year-old, currently at a career-high No. 215 in the Pepperstone ATP Rankings, did not drop a set during qualifying. It is the first time Zeppieri has qualified for a Grand Slam.

Bernabe Zapata Miralles booked his spot in the main draw for the second consecutive year, rallying past #NextGenATP Italian Luca Nardi 3-6, 6-4, 6-1 in the final qualifying round. The Spaniard recovered from a slow start against Nardi, who is 10th in the Pepperstone ATP Race To Milan, to advance after one hour and 59 minutes.

Portugal’s Nuno Borges will make his Roland Garros debut after he eliminated Hungarian Zsombor Piros 3-6, 6-2, 6-1 in one hour and 45 minutes. The World No. 126 is now 25-9 across all levels this season.

In his fifth qualifying attempt, Czech Zdenek Kolar finally reached the main draw in Paris with a 6-3, 6-4 win over Italian Franco Agamenone, while Australian Jason Kubler defeated Portugal’s Pedro Sousa 7-5, 6-2.

Austrian Sebastian Ofner, who lifted an ATP Challenger Tour title in Prague in April, moved past Italian Alessandro Giannessi 6-4, 1-6, 6-2 and Borna Gojo downed Argentine Juan Ignacio Londero 7-6(1), 6-1. Gojo lost in qualifying at all four Grand Slams in 2021, but produced a dominant performance to ensure he did not suffer more heartbreak.

Argentine Santiago Fa Rodriguez Taverna will make his Grand Slam debut after edging Dimitar Kuzmanov 6-4, 3-6, 6-3.
